In Module 11 participants will learn ways to increase students comprehension of varied texts and check understanding through tasks such as writing responses, completing specific graphic organizers and outlines, and applying what has been learned to a new reading. (Focus: Grades Three through Adult)
Objectives
Module 11 Attendees will:
- Review causes of reading comprehension difficulties.
- Understand the importance of vocabulary knowledge for comprehension.
- Understand and learn to implement the Key Three Routine.
- Plan schoolwide support for implementation of the Key Three Routine and other study strategies.
